更新时间:2024-11-29 GMT+08:00
分享

查询磁盘自动扩容策略

功能介绍

查询磁盘自动扩容策略。

调试

您可以在API Explorer中调试该接口。

URI

GET /v3/{project_id}/instances/{instance_id}/auto-enlarge-volume-policy
表1 路径参数

参数

是否必选

参数类型

描述

project_id

String

租户在某一Region下的Project ID。

instance_id

String

实例ID。

请求参数

表2 请求Header参数

参数

是否必选

参数类型

描述

X-Auth-Token

String

从IAM服务获取的用户Token。请参考认证鉴权

响应参数

状态码: 200

表3 响应Body参数

参数

参数类型

描述

switch_option

String

自动扩容开关。

  • on:开启磁盘自动扩容策略。
  • off: 关闭磁盘自动扩容策略。

    默认值为on。

policy

Array of objects

磁盘自动扩容策略。详情请参见表4

表4 DiskAutoExpansionPolicy

参数

参数类型

描述

instance_id

String

实例ID。

threshold

Integer

触发自动扩容阈值,只支持输入80、85和90。默认阈值为90,即当已使用存储空间达到总存储空间的90%时就会触发扩容。集群实例的自动扩容阈值指的是每个shard。

step

Integer

扩容步长(s%),默认为10,支持输入10、15和20。当触发自动扩容的时候,自动扩容当前存储空间的s%(非10倍数向上取整。小数点后四舍五入,默认一次最小10G,账户余额不足时,会导致包年包月实例扩容失败)。

状态码: 400

表5 响应Body参数

参数

参数类型

描述

error_code

String

错误码。

error_msg

String

错误消息。

状态码: 500

表6 响应Body参数

参数

参数类型

描述

error_code

String

错误码。

error_msg

String

错误消息。

请求示例

GET https://{endpoint}/v3/619d3e78f61b4be68bc5aa0b59edcf7b/instances/93e4b3eda14349b1b870f72829bc3b9bin02/auto-enlarge-volume-policy

响应示例

状态码: 200
Success
{ 
  "switch_option" : "off", 
  "policy" : { 
    "instance_id" : "93e4b3eda14349b1b870f72829bc3b9bin02", 
    "threshold" : 90, 
    "step" : 10 
  } 
}

状态码

状态码

描述

200

Success

400

Client error.

500

Server error.

错误码

详情请参见错误码

相关文档